Around film

  • turning was held with Pittsburgh.
  • Tom Tully, with which one owes the history of film, makes a small appearance in the role of Deke Taylor.
  • the make-up are the work of Tom Savini.
  • the film was to be initially called Picking Up the Pieces .
  • Following the many reassemblies imposed by the production, the scenario writer repudiated his film by signing it Alan Smithee.
  • Beverly Penberthy, which interprets the accro with the cigarette Erma Birdwell, is also producing film.
